snowflakes fall fast and slow,
i wonder where it is that they will go.
will they drift forever more,
or melt upon the forest floor?
maybe if i could tell
i would kno where the first one fell.
its silly to think that isnt it so?
to wonder where the snowflakes go?
mostly soft and white or blue,
i wonder where they go to..
my mother finds it silly still
but i sit on the window sill
the flakes are drifting sliding through,
what else am i supposed to do?
but still they fall both fast and slow,
and i still wonder where it is they will go..
